Перенос сайта на другой хостинг без простоя: чеклист
Перенос. Чаще всего ломается не сайт, а почта и записи DNS — их проверяют отдельно, до переключения.
Запросы "перенос сайта на другой хостинг без простоя" я люблю, потому что там всё решается дисциплиной, а не "магией админа".
1. До переключения
- Полный бэкап файлов + базы (если есть).
- Стейджинг на новом IP, проверка форм и редиректов.
- TTL DNS заранее опустить, если планируете быстрый откат.
2. В день переключения
Меняем A-записи, ждём пропагацию, проверяем SSL (часто забывают сертификат на новом сервере), смотрим почту - не улетела ли в старый ящик.
Если после переноса "лежит только у меня" - значит, не дождались DNS, а не "сломался интернет".
База про домен и SSL - старая добрая статья про хостинг.
rsync на новый VPS
rsync -avz --delete /var/www/old/ user@new-host:/var/www/site/
dump MySQL
mysqldump -u root -p dbname | ssh user@new-host "mysql -u root -p dbname"
Порядок действий, чтобы сайт не «лежал» лишний день
Сначала делают копию всех файлов и базы, поднимают копию на новом месте, проверяют, потом аккуратно переключают адрес. Почта и защищённое соединение проверяют отдельно — там чаще всего забывают детали.
Почта — самое частое место сюрпризов
Уточните, где у вас почта: на хостинге, у Google, у Яндекса или ещё где. При переносе важно, чтобы письма не начали улетать в никуда из‑за неправильных технических записей. Если не понимаете слов «MX‑запись» — попросите подрядчика нарисовать схему простыми стрелками.
Корзина и «запомнил меня»
Иногда после переноса сайт открывается, а корзина ведёт себя странно. Это лечится настройкой сервера — не ваша вина, просто об этом стоит знать и проверить заранее тестовой покупкой.
Статья про перенос сайта на другой хостинг без простоя: чеклист — для тех, кто деплоит свой фронт или ведёт pet-проект на VPS. Я собираю типовой путь, который повторяю на коммерческих лендингах и MVP.
Типовой порядок работ
- Собрать production-билд фронта (
npm run build) и проверить локально черезpreview. - Настроить VPS: пользователь, firewall, SSH-ключи, обновления ОС.
- Поставить Nginx/Caddy, отдать статику из
dist/, настроить gzip/brotli и кэш. - Подключить домен, DNS, SSL (Let's Encrypt / Certbot).
- Добавить мониторинг: логи, алерт при падении, бэкап конфигов.
Для Node-бэкенда отдельно — process manager (PM2/systemd) и reverse proxy, а не открытый порт наружу.
Типичные ошибки
Перегруз эффектами и библиотеками «на всякий случай»; отсутствие проверки на слабом интернете и старых телефонах; копирование чужого дизайна без адаптации под свою аудиторию; отсутствие явного CTA; ожидание, что «сайт сам продаст» без трафика и оффера.
Для коммерческих проектов отдельно болит размытое ТЗ и бесконечные правки без доплаты — лечится этапами и лимитом итераций.
Когда имеет смысл привлечь разработчика
Если нужен не шаблон, а связка дизайна, скорости, интеграций и сопровождения — проще обсудить задачу один раз, чем чинить конструктор полгода. Я беру лендинги, визитки и MVP под ключ; ориентиры по срокам и бюджету — на странице цен.
Читать дальше
- Core Web Vitals — метрики скорости
- Vite вместо CRA — стек сборки
- Услуги — разработка под задачу
Короткие ответы на частые вопросы
Это подойдёт моему бизнесу? Если вам нужен понятный сайт с заявкой или звонком — да; если десятки кабинетов и сложная логика — обсудим отдельный объём.
Что подготовить до старта? Тексты или тезисы, логотип, примеры конкурентов, доступы к домену и хостингу (если уже есть).
Как оценить результат? Скорость на мобилке, ясный CTA, отсутствие «битых» блоков и совпадение страницы с рекламой/поисковым запросом.
Итог по теме «Перенос сайта на другой хостинг без простоя: чеклист»
Сфокусируйтесь на сценарии пользователя, а не на количестве фич. Остальное — вопрос исполнения и дисциплины в проекте. Готов помочь с оценкой — контакты или Telegram из кнопки ниже.
Хотите обсудить похожую задачу для своего проекта — без обязаловки.
Написать в Telegram →